Emma Roberts' son experienced the Happiest Place on Earth for the first time ever.

The American Horror Story actress, 33, shared a sweet photo on her Instagram of herself and her 3-year-old son Rhodes as they spent the day together at Disneyland. Posing in front of the Sleeping Beauty castle, Roberts sat on a bench and had her arm around her son, who faced away from the camera and looked out over the moat.

"The only thing that could make the most magical place on earth more magical? seeing it with your son for the first time 🌟 @disneyland 🩵 @disneyparks 📸," Roberts wrote in her caption.

The actress also gave a glimpse of their day on her Instagram Stories, showing her and her little boy walking around the park together and going on a few rides.

Roberts shares her son with ex Garret Hedlund.

Earlier this month, the proud mom shared an adorable photo on Instagram as she received a big hug from her son Rhodes. In the picture, the toddler ran to his mom, arms outstretched and sporting a grin as Roberts bent down, ready to receive her son's hug.

"Best feeling in the world 🩵," Roberts wrote in her caption.

The week before, the star brought Architectural Digest into her home in a video posted on April 16 and showed the outlet around her house. As she described different furniture pieces in her living room, Roberts held up a worn-out chair, noting that it had been in her life for quite some time.

“This chair was my time-out chair when I was a kid. It had to come with me to my houses and now my son sits in it and loves it," Roberts said of her toddler son.

"And so it just makes me kind of laugh to myself when I think about it. And we still call it the time-out chair. Like my mom will be like, ‘Oh my god, the time-out chair!’ But yeah. She’s seen it all."
